• Introduction to Pedestrian Safety Programs: Understanding the importance of implementing pedestrian safety programs and the impact on community safety.
• Identifying High-Risk Areas: Techniques for identifying areas with high pedestrian crash rates and factors contributing to pedestrian crashes.
• Engineering Solutions for Pedestrian Safety: Designing streets and intersections to improve pedestrian safety, including sidewalks, crosswalks, and traffic calming measures.
• Education and Awareness Campaigns: Developing and implementing effective education and awareness campaigns to promote pedestrian safety.
• Enforcement Strategies: Examining effective enforcement strategies to improve pedestrian safety, including traffic laws and regulations.
• Evaluation of Pedestrian Safety Programs: Techniques for evaluating the effectiveness of pedestrian safety programs and making data-driven decisions.
• Collaboration and Partnerships: Building partnerships with stakeholders, including community groups, law enforcement, and transportation officials, to support pedestrian safety programs.
• Legislation and Policy: Understanding the role of legislation and policy in promoting pedestrian safety and creating safe environments for pedestrians.
• Sustainable Funding for Pedestrian Safety Programs: Exploring sustainable funding sources and strategies to support pedestrian safety programs.
